I have following layout:
\---tests
| test_module.py
| __init__.py
When I launch "python.exe" -m unittest discover -t . -s tests" it works
perfectly.
But when I remove " __init__.py" it says
Start directory is not importable: "tests'"
``loader.py``:
if start_dir != top_level_dir:
is_not_importable = not os.path.isfile(os.path.join(start_dir,
'__init__.py'))
I believe ``__init__.py`` does not play any role since Python 3.3, am I
right?
If so, it seems to be a bug. Should I create an issue?
